Collaborate Without Giving Up Your Own CRM
Team Accounts create a connection between AGENTVIEW users so people can work together without merging every contact, task, or transaction into one shared account.
That makes it practical for agents to co-manage opportunities, for brokers to have visibility where needed, and for teammates to stay coordinated without losing individual control.
You Decide What Each Connection Can Work With
Every team relationship can be different. One teammate may need access to shared contacts and tasks, while a broker may only need visibility into certain transactions.
AGENTVIEW lets you control what is shared so collaboration does not mean giving everyone unrestricted access to your entire database.
Bring the People Around a Transaction Into the Same Workflow
Invite teammates and transaction participants into the deal so the people responsible for moving it forward can see the information that matters.
AGENTVIEW can also bring outside participants such as escrow officers, transaction coordinators, lenders, and co-agents into specific transactions—even when they do not have their own AGENTVIEW account.
